1. A power battery heating method, configured for heating a power battery of a vehicle having a three-phase alternating current motor, a motor controller, and a heat conduction loop, the power battery heating method comprising:
obtaining a current temperature value of the power battery, and determining whether the current temperature value of the power battery is lower than a preset temperature value;
determining whether a current working status of the three-phase alternating current motor is a non-driving state, and whether one of the power battery, the three-phase alternating current motor, the motor controller, or the heat conduction loop is faulty;
in response to determining that the current temperature value of the power battery is lower than the preset temperature value, that the current working status of the three-phase alternating current motor is a non-driving state, and that none of the power battery, the three-phase alternating current motor, the motor controller, or the heat conduction loop is faulty, obtaining heating power of the power battery;
obtaining a preset quadrature-axis current, and obtaining a corresponding preset direct-axis current according to the heating power of the power battery, wherein a value of the obtained preset quadrature-axis current is a quadrature-axis current value that causes a torque value outputted by a three-phase alternating current motor to fall within a target range, and the target range does not comprise zero; and
controlling an on/off status of a power device in a three-phase inverter, so that the three-phase alternating current motor generates heat according to heating energy provided by a heating energy source to heat a coolant flowing through the power battery, and controlling, according to the preset direct-axis current and the preset quadrature-axis current, the three-phase inverter to adjust a phase current of the three-phase alternating current motor in a heating process of the power battery.
